First collaboration, released in 1990.

There's only one original song here - there are six contemporaryish covers, and three traditional tunes - but that's not unusual for Folk musicians.

More gently Rocked-up Folk, that sounds a bit like 10 000 Maniacs.

Good, but not as strong as the aforementioned Ragged Kingdom album.

Their first best of set, including the #4 pop hit Flowers On The Wall. That was their only song to score high on the pop charts, but the country hits kept coming. Highest charting on this set were Flowers and Do You Remember These, both #2 country hits. My favorite is The Class of '57 where the nostalgia reigns. A song about the groups graduating class and where are they now. The groups roots were in country gospel as Four Star Quartet and then the Kingsmen. The Kingsmen turned out to be already taken by some guys that had a minor hit called Louie Louie. Name was changed to the Statler Brothers. From Virginia the two brothers of Harold and Don Reid, plus Phil Balsley and Lew DeWitt. Lew was replaced by Jimmy Fortune after his ill health with Crohns Disease. Beginning in 1964 the group had an 8 year run as the opening act for the man in black. Numerous awards throughout the years, most after this compilation, but this includes some of their best work.

Dance of the Moon and the Sun-Natural Snow Buildings

A 2005 French drone-folk-bient double album that clocks in at almost two hours. Shockingly etheral and beautiful. I seldom finish the album, not becasue it fails to hold my attention but rather because, as a teenager, I have alot more things to attend to than droney French folk music. When I do, though, it's truly a rewarding experience
